I think you are very unlikely to find the memoirs of Rose Hickman
(later Throckmorton, nee Locke) online David.

I spent a long time looking for it!

It can be bought here
http://www.adam-matthew-publications.co ... thors.aspx

I contacted the British Library direct and they wanted 42 pounds for a
copy.

It was at that point I did more hunting and found it quoted in an
article available from London University and I have a copy I am
willing to share with anyone who'd find it useful.
However I have since found the same article mentioned and what looks
like a large part of the autobiography on pages 29-32 of "Religion &
Society in Early Modern England" edited by David Cressy and Lorri Anne
Ferrell ISBN 0 415 11849 2
